Full-Body Scanners Under Trial at Key Indian Airports
Implementation of Security Technology:
The Bureau of Civil Aviation Security (BCAS) has initiated trials for full-body scanners at four major metropolitan airports, including Delhi, Bengaluru, Hyderabad, and Kochi. These trials, which commenced in May 2026, are scheduled to span three months to assess operational efficiency. The initiative aims to modernize security infrastructure and streamline passenger processing by minimizing the necessity for traditional, manual physical frisking during pre-flight screenings.
Expansion of Security Protocols:
Following the initial deployment at metro hubs, the BCAS has directed authorities in Srinagar, Jammu, and Ayodhya to install similar screening technology. The mandate applies specifically to airports that handle an annual passenger volume exceeding 50 lakh, signaling a broader push toward standardized high-tech security across India's aviation network. This shift follows years of testing and evaluating various scanner technologies intended to enhance both the speed and accuracy of security checks.
Significance for Aviation Security:
The adoption of full-body scanning technology is expected to significantly reduce wait times while maintaining robust security standards. As trials conclude later this year, the results will likely dictate the timeline for a nationwide rollout at other busy domestic terminals. This transition represents a major technological upgrade for the Central Industrial Security Force, which oversees security at most Indian airports.
